Unity跑酷游戏完整资源包:源码、资料及框架图

6 下载量 10 浏览量 更新于2024-10-25 1 收藏 150.04MB RAR 举报
资源摘要信息: 本资源包为Unity平台上的跑酷游戏项目,包含了游戏的完整源代码、详细的学习资料、以及游戏框架图等,旨在为学习者提供一个全面的学习素材。通过实际运行和学习这个项目,用户可以深入理解Unity游戏开发流程,掌握跑酷游戏的核心机制,以及熟悉Unity引擎中的相关编程和资源管理技巧。本资源适用于Unity初学者和具有一定经验的游戏开发者,帮助他们在实践中提升开发能力,并能够亲自体验游戏的趣味性。资源中还可能包含了角色模型、环境贴图、音效文件等多样化的素材,旨在提供一个完整的游戏开发体验。 1. Unity游戏开发基础:Unity是一个跨平台的游戏开发引擎,支持多种操作系统和游戏设备。该资源包可以让用户从零开始学习Unity引擎的基础知识,如场景搭建、角色控制、摄像机跟随等。通过跑酷游戏的开发,用户可以了解到Unity编辑器的使用方法,包括层级(Layer)的管理、精灵(Sprites)的使用、物理引擎的应用等。 2. 源码分析:资源包中的完整源码是学习和理解Unity脚本编写的重要途径。源码将展示如何使用C#语言进行游戏编程,包括但不限于控制角色跳跃、滑动、躲避障碍物等动作的实现。用户可以通过阅读和运行源码来理解游戏逻辑,学习如何处理用户输入、碰撞检测、得分系统等核心游戏功能。 3. 学习资料:为了帮助学习者更快地上手和理解跑酷游戏开发,资源包可能包含了相关的文字教程、视频讲解、API文档等学习资料。这些资料可以帮助用户了解Unity的各个组件和功能,以及如何将它们整合在一起制作出一个完整的游戏。 4. 框架图:框架图是游戏开发中的一个重要参考,它展示了游戏的整体架构和各个模块之间的关系。通过框架图,用户可以清晰地看到游戏的各个系统如何协作,如游戏管理、用户界面(UI)、动画控制、音效播放等模块的设计。这有助于用户在进行后续开发时更好地组织代码和资源。 5. 游戏素材:资源包中的素材,如角色模型、动画、背景图像、音效等,是游戏开发的重要组成部分。通过这些素材,用户可以了解到如何为游戏赋予视觉和听觉效果,以及如何在游戏中运用这些元素来增加玩家的沉浸感和趣味性。 6. 实践应用:通过亲测游戏,用户可以验证自己学习的成果,即通过实际操作游戏来理解理论知识和源码的运行效果。这种实践方式能够加深用户对Unity跑酷游戏开发的理解,帮助用户将理论知识转化为实际技能。 综上所述,这个Unity跑酷游戏资源包是一个全面的学习工具,它不仅提供了亲测好玩的游戏体验,也是一份优质的学习资料,能够帮助用户从多个维度掌握Unity游戏开发的关键技能,对于有意深入学习Unity引擎和游戏开发的用户来说,是非常有价值的学习资源。